April 2 - The online gambling company - Sportingbet PLC, has announced that it intends to relocate the business to the Channel Islands.
The reason for the move is due to ambiguity that surrounds the requirements of the 2005 UK Gambling Act. This has seen the Channel Islands, which does not operate within UK mainland law turn into an attractive option for the company.
In a statement, Sportingbet said that its most practical course of action is to move the activities that it anticipates may be covered by the Act, to a jurisdiction that has a more definite regulatory environment. The move is set to take place by September 1.
